NAME
|
||||
EvalMath - safely evaluate math expressions
|
||||
|
||||
SYNOPSIS
|
||||
include('evalmath.class.php');
|
||||
$m = new EvalMath;
|
||||
// basic evaluation:
|
||||
$result = $m->evaluate('2+2');
|
||||
// supports: order of operation; parentheses; negation; built-in functions
|
||||
$result = $m->evaluate('-8(5/2)^2*(1-sqrt(4))-8');
|
||||
// create your own variables
|
||||
$m->evaluate('a = e^(ln(pi))');
|
||||
// or functions
|
||||
$m->evaluate('f(x,y) = x^2 + y^2 - 2x*y + 1');
|
||||
// and then use them
|
||||
$result = $m->evaluate('3*f(42,a)');
|
||||
|
||||
DESCRIPTION
|
||||
Use the EvalMath class when you want to evaluate mathematical expressions
|
||||
from untrusted sources. You can define your own variables and functions,
|
||||
which are stored in the object. Try it, it's fun!
|
||||
|
||||
METHODS
|
||||
$m->evalute($expr)
|
||||
Evaluates the expression and returns the result. If an error occurs,
|
||||
prints a warning and returns false. If $expr is a function assignment,
|
||||
returns true on success.
|
||||
|
||||
$m->e($expr)
|
||||
A synonym for $m->evaluate().
|
||||
|
||||
$m->vars()
|
||||
Returns an associative array of all user-defined variables and values.
|
||||
|
||||
$m->funcs()
|
||||
Returns an array of all user-defined functions.
|
||||
|
||||
PARAMETERS
|
||||
$m->suppress_errors
|
||||
Set to true to turn off warnings when evaluating expressions
|
||||
|
||||
$m->last_error
|
||||
If the last evaluation failed, contains a string describing the error.
|
||||
(Useful when suppress_errors is on).
|
||||
|
||||
$m->last_error_code
|
||||
If the last evaluation failed, 2 element array with numeric code and extra info
